Pollitt, Frye exchange vows
Marsha K. Pollitt of Ripley, Ohio and Wilbur G. Frye of Vanceburg, were married Oct. 25, 2007, at the home of Marsha's parents, Charlie E. Pollitt Sr. and Beverelee J. Pollitt, in Ripley. They were married by Judge and Mayor of Ripley, Tom Leonard.
Wilbur is the son of Linda L. Leming of Vanceburg and the late Wilbur Lee Frye.
The lovely bride was given in marriage by her parents, Charlie and Beverelee Pollitt.
Serving as maid of honor was Billie J. Kirk, sister of the bride, of Russellville, Ohio and serving as the bridesmaid was Elizabeth Coffey of Dover. Krysta L. Pollitt, daughter of the bride, of Ripley, was the flower girl.
Tony Kirk, brother-in-law of the bride, of Russellville, was the best man and John Kirschner, nephew of the bride, of Russellville served as the groomsman. Jacob T. Bell, son of the bride, of Ripley served as the ring bearer.
A reception was held at the home of the bride following the service.
The bride is a graduate of Ripley High School and is a homemaker.
Wilbur is a graduate of Lewis County High School and is a craftsman for Enerfab.
The couple honeymooned in Niagara Fall, N.Y. and is now residing in Vanceburg.
